Some things to note when using electronic scales:
- keep away from any drafts, air movement, etc. (don't put it on your bench under a HVAC register/vent, for example) Some models, like the GEM, etc. have covers which eliminate the 'air variable factor'
- buy and use a good set of check weights: these are NOT what the scale will come with, they're calibrated pieces of metal that are known to be an exact weight. Use them when recalibrating your scale, or setting it up, and/or periodically checking its 'zero'
- make sure the power supply is as stable as possible
- be sure to place on a stable, level surface and try not to move it once it's setup!
